KANNUR:  After losing the initial momentum and with the infiltration of external forces having caused confusion among the agitators, the much-celebrated resistance of Vayalkkilikal at Keezhattur looks set for a premature ending, much to the dismay of the region’s environmentalists.

The constant pressure applied by the CPM through diplomacy and threats, the unflinching attitude of the LDF Government in implementing development projects at any cost and the failure of the agitators to garner support from the people outside Keezhattur are considered to be the reasons for the fiasco.
